What is Dropbox Sign
Dropbox Sign is an eSignature tool designed to help users get contracts signed faster and more securely. It fits in the digital signing category, making paperwork simple with legally binding signatures and audit trails. Users appreciate its easy setup, automated follow-ups, and the ability to sign documents anywhere, anytime.
It shines in sales contracts, employee onboarding, NDAs, and proposal signing where speed and efficiency matter. You can start sending signed documents in minutes and see results immediately, speeding up processes from weeks to days or even minutes in some cases.
Dropbox Sign integrates seamlessly with popular tools like Gmail, Salesforce, Slack, and Google Docs to fit smoothly into your existing workflow. It’s not meant for complex contract lifecycle management or in-depth document editing but excels at quick, reliable signature collection for teams and developers.

How simple is Dropbox Sign setup?
Complexity
Complexity
Dropbox Sign is almost ready to use out of the box with just creating an account and starting a free trial. For embedding eSignatures or API use, basic configuration like adding snippets or connecting accounts is needed, which can be completed solo in minutes.
Frequently Asked Questions
How to use Dropbox Sign?
Create an account, upload documents, add signer fields, and send for signatures from any device anytime, with integrated workflows.
How much is Dropbox Sign?
Plans start at $15/user/month with unlimited signature requests; team plans and custom quotes available for larger needs.
Why choose Dropbox Sign?
It offers legally-binding eSignatures, fast signing processes, seamless integrations, and secure, tamper-proof document handling.
How does Dropbox Sign work?
Send documents digitally, sign electronically with audit trails, and track progress with automated reminders and notifications.
Is Dropbox Sign free?
Yes, it offers a free plan for signing documents and a 30-day free trial for paid plans.
Is Dropbox Sign a partner?
Yes, Dropbox Sign integrates with partners like Google Drive, HubSpot, Salesforce, and more for streamlined workflows.
How to learn Dropbox Sign?
Access tutorials, webinars, help center, API guides, and resource videos for smooth onboarding and workflow automation.
What are Dropbox Sign alternatives?
Alternatives include DocuSign, Adobe Sign, PandaDoc, and SignNow for electronic signature solutions.
What are Dropbox Sign reviews?
Users praise fast implementation, mobile-friendly signing, improved completion rates up to 26%, and excellent customer support.
Does Dropbox Sign have an API?
Yes, the API starts at $100 for 50 requests/month to embed eSignatures into apps quickly and securely.
Does Dropbox Sign have a trial or a demo?
Yes, there is a 30-day free trial with unlimited signatures and no commitment during the trial period.
